Understanding Bonuses and Wagering Requirements

Bonuses are the headline grabbers, but the hidden cost is the wagering requirement. That’s the number of times you must play through the bonus money before you can withdraw any winnings. A 30x requirement on a AU$100 bonus means you need to bet AU$3,000 first.

We recommend focusing on low‑to‑medium wagering ratios (20x–30x) and checking if the requirement applies to the deposit, the bonus, or both. Some operators also exclude certain games from contributing to the wagering total – usually high‑RTP slots are counted, while table games are ignored.

Payment Methods and Withdrawal Speed in Australia

Australian players have a range of deposit options: credit/debit cards, POLi, PayID, and popular e‑wallets like Skrill and Neteller. The key is to match the method with the withdrawal speed you expect.

Instant payouts are usually only available with e‑wallets; bank transfers can take 2‑4 business days, while POLi often settles within the same day. Keep an eye on any hidden fees – some casinos charge a small percentage on credit card deposits.

Typical Deposit Methods

  • Visa / MasterCard – widely accepted, but may incur a 2% fee.
  • PayID – Australian‑focused, fast and usually fee‑free.
  • Skrill / Neteller – instant, good for quick withdrawals.
  • POLi – direct bank transfer, settlement in minutes.

Registration, Verification and KYC Process

Signing up is usually a few minutes: email, password, and a few personal details. The real work begins with the Know‑Your‑Customer (KYC) verification – you’ll be asked for ID, proof of address and sometimes a selfie.

Australian regulations require this step to prevent fraud. Operators that process verification within 24 hours are a big plus, especially if you’re chasing a time‑sensitive bonus.
